Spec-Zone .ru
спецификации, руководства, описания, API
|
@Target(value=METHOD) @Retention(value=RUNTIME) public @interface Transient
value
когда Introspector
конструкции a PropertyDescriptor
или EventSetDescriptor
классы связались с аннотируемым элементом кода. A true
значение для "переходного" атрибута указывает к кодерам, полученным из Encoder
то, что эта функция должна быть проигнорирована. Transient
аннотация может быть использоваться в любом из методов, которые включаются в a FeatureDescriptor
подкласс, чтобы идентифицировать переходную функцию в аннотируемом class и его подклассах. Обычно, метод, который запускается с, "добирается", лучшее место, чтобы поместить аннотацию, и именно это объявление имеет приоритет в случае многократных аннотаций, определяемых для той же самой функции. Чтобы объявить непереходный процесс функции в class, суперкласс которого объявляет это переходный процесс, использовать @Transient(false)
. Во всех случаях, Introspector
решает, является ли функция переходным процессом, ссылаясь на аннотацию на самый определенный суперкласс. Если нет Transient
аннотация присутствует в любом суперклассе, функция не является переходным процессом.Модификатор и Тип | Дополнительный Элемент и Описание |
---|---|
boolean |
значение |
Для дальнейшей ссылки API и документации разработчика, см. Java Документация SE. Та документация содержит более подробные, предназначенные разработчиком описания, с концептуальными краткими обзорами, определениями сроков, обходных решений, и рабочих примеров кода.
Авторское право © 1993, 2013, Oracle и/или его филиалы. Все права защищены.
Проект сборка-b92